Michael L. Pinette, Partner

Mike Pinette has more than 25 years of experience in a wide variety of manufacturing environments, specializing in operational improvement for underperforming and nonperforming companies. He has experience in many industries, including:

  • Aluminum rolling
  • Automotive
  • Boiler manufacturing
  • Commercial banking
  • Computer
  • Furniture
  • Grocery retail
  • Home building
  • Meat processing
  • Metal working
  • Plastics and rubber
  • Snack Food
  • Wire and Cable

Mr. Pinette has served in numerous advisory and management roles, assessing, developing and implementing effective solutions to complex situations. A few noteworthy engagements include:

  • Led the improvement efforts for the underperforming Polish manufacturing operations of a global EMS client, where he reduced inventory by 40%, redesigned manufacturing operations, and designed and instituted tools to fully utilize ERP cost and financial capabilities
  • COO of a vertically integrated wood products company, which he reorganized during its workout, streamlining manufacturing operations and successfully completing the refinancing process
  • Solved major bottleneck in an automotive engine plant, resulting in an immediate 10% increase in output and a 20% increase with recommended production line redesign
  • Developed approach to realize $20 million in savings for a financial services company by migrating customer service to the Web
  • Drove supply chain initiatives for a grocery chain, resulting in a $5 million annual transportation savings and a 45% stock-out reduction

Previously, Mr. Pinette worked as an independent turnaround consultant. Prior to that, he served as a manager at Bain & Company, where he was recognized for worldwide contributions in operations and manufacturing. He developed manufacturing strategies for Fortune 500 companies and supported the company’s private equity groups with quick-turn manufacturing due diligence.

Mr. Pinette holds a bachelor’s degree in industrial management from Lowell Technological Institute and an MBA from American International College. He currently sits on the board of directors for Activplant, an EMI software company based in Canada. Mr. Pinette is actively involved with the company, serving on its M&A committee, its audit committee and as an outside director.
